Peter Papia 1913 - 1998

Peter Papia of Long Beach, Los Angeles County, CA was born on November 29, 1913, and died at age 84 years old on March 10, 1998.

In 1913, in the year that Peter Papia was born, Woodrow Wilson became the 28th President of the United States in March. Previously the Governor of New Jersey and President of Princeton University, he was the first Southerner to serve as President since Zachary Taylor, over 60 years previous. A Democrat, he led the U.S. during World War I and championed the League of Nations.
